Southgate homeowner shoots, kills home invasion suspect

A suspected home invader was fatally shot Thursday morning in Southgate by the homeowner. 

The homeowner and his wife were awoken around 4:30 a.m. He grabbed his legal firearm and fired at the intruder, who was also armed, according to Southgate Police Department's director, Thomas Coombs. 

Charges are pending against the homeowner. 

"You can, obviously, defend your home if someone comes into your home. The intruder was armed, so, yes, you can defend yourself," says Coombs. 

Police are not releasing identities at this time, but the homeowners are said to be a man and a woman in their 60s. 

The shooting happened at a home in the 15000 block of Flanders Street, which is near the intersection of Allen and Eureka roads. 

"This is a very, very quiet neighborhood through here. Nothing goes on. This is very surprising," says Rick Mercer, whose daughter lives nearby.
